Transaction 2ec739768727887c2a9cb983f8e7b20d0bc12e25a4a5b4681ebd66a79de6c619

1 Input
2 Outputs
  • 2ec739768727887c2a9cb983f8e7b20d0bc12e25a4a5b4681ebd66a79de6c619:0
  • value  375003
    address  3NHffUo28zV9XsvzhMCAkdeGbEasLLaUWy
  • 2ec739768727887c2a9cb983f8e7b20d0bc12e25a4a5b4681ebd66a79de6c619:1
  • value  672624354
    address  3JEZJFHJUC51d9FRkjtTNL8uskL21zYmhi